Eric12324
本帖最后由 Eric12324 于 2020-2-8 15:44 编辑
Eric12324 发表于 2020-2-8 00:46
琢磨了一天用几十行代码大致实现了一下,然后还添加了一个title公告模式(中间这个),我没有用过那个 ...

@酷车手BB弹

更新了,可以设置颜色和持续时间,api提供七种颜色可选,公告内容依然支持placeholderAPI,间隔时间的设置跟之前一样
使用血条公告只要把display改成boss就可以,可以自由在三种显示模式切换
目前我直接测试了一下还是相对满意的,就不知道符不符合你的要求了。。
暂时没发现什么bug,不过还是打个Beta标签

3448737105
感谢作者分享

qq107289387
作者可以添加个换行操作吗?有时候为了美观要自己打空格有点麻烦

Javi_Li
很好的插件,感谢分享

Javi_Li
很好的插件,感谢分享

SpicyFish
论坛上的两款公告插件的整合加强版~ 感谢作者大大的原创插件~ 就很nice就很棒~

SpicyFish
请问这个公告间隔应该如何设置呢
A公告
# 服务端启动后,等待多久启动该公告(避免相同间隔时间的公告挤在一起,该项只能手动设置)
DelayOnStart=110
# 间隔时间段模式下,公告间隔时间,单位:秒
Interval=60

B公告
# 服务端启动后,等待多久启动该公告(避免相同间隔时间的公告挤在一起,该项只能手动设置)
DelayOnStart=260
# 间隔时间段模式下,公告间隔时间,单位:秒
Interval=60
结果是同一时间刷出来。。不知道该如何设置= =
如图

Eric12324
HHD统治 发表于 2020-3-14 20:20
请问这个公告间隔应该如何设置呢
A公告
# 服务端启动后,等待多久启动该公告(避免相同间隔时间的公告挤在 ...

你把你的配置文件发我一份,用那个代码格式,就在插入图片哪里,那个<>符号

SpicyFish
本帖最后由 HHD统治 于 2020-3-14 23:20 编辑
Eric12324 发表于 2020-3-14 21:22
你把你的配置文件发我一份,用那个代码格式,就在插入图片哪里,那个符号 ...
  1. All {
  2.     "NO.1" {
  3.         Cmd=None
  4.         Content="&f[&b萌主公告&f]&a输入&n{item}&a发送手中物品信息至聊天框中,&c{item $1}&a发送快捷栏一号位置的物品信息"
  5.         DelayOnStart=120
  6.         Display=normal
  7.         Enable=true
  8.         FixTime=[
  9.             "12:00"
  10.         ]
  11.         Hover="{item $0~9}展示快捷栏中0~9的物品,例如{item $9}展示快捷栏从左往右数第九个快捷的物品"
  12.         Interval=60
  13.         Join=false
  14.         ModeCode=interval
  15.         Setting {
  16.             Boss {
  17.                 持续时间=10
  18.                 颜色=PURPLE
  19.             }
  20.             Title {
  21.                 持续时间=2
  22.                 淡入时间=1
  23.                 淡出时间=1
  24.             }
  25.         }
  26.         Url=None
  27.     }
  28.     "NO.2" {
  29.         Cmd="/latch"
  30.         Content="&f[&b萌主公告&f]&a牌子锁插件请输入指令&n/latch&a查看指令详情 点击可直接查看"
  31.         DelayOnStart=60
  32.         Display=normal
  33.         Enable=true
  34.         FixTime=[
  35.             "12:00"
  36.         ]
  37.         Hover="&e↓点击打开↓"
  38.         Interval=60
  39.         Join=false
  40.         ModeCode=interval
  41.         Setting {
  42.             Boss {
  43.                 持续时间=10
  44.                 颜色=PURPLE
  45.             }
  46.             Title {
  47.                 持续时间=2
  48.                 淡入时间=1
  49.                 淡出时间=1
  50.             }
  51.         }
  52.         Url=None
  53.     }
  54.     "NO.3" {
  55.         Cmd=None
  56.         Content="&f[&b萌主公告&f]&2阿特拉斯世界的猩红炼狱、末影之地,由于没有&7&n神圣魔法&2的保护,死亡会&c&n掉落物品"
  57.         DelayOnStart=180
  58.         Display=normal
  59.         Enable=true
  60.         FixTime=[
  61.             "12:00"
  62.         ]
  63.         Hover=""
  64.         Interval=60
  65.         Join=false
  66.         ModeCode=interval
  67.         Setting {
  68.             Boss {
  69.                 持续时间=10
  70.                 颜色=PURPLE
  71.             }
  72.             Title {
  73.                 持续时间=2
  74.                 淡入时间=1
  75.                 淡出时间=1
  76.             }
  77.         }
  78.         Url=None
  79.     }
  80.     "NO.4" {
  81.         Cmd=None
  82.         Content="&f[&b萌主公告&f]&a&n点击链接加入群聊【Minecraft萌の国度 1.12.2】"
  83.         DelayOnStart=240
  84.         Display=normal
  85.         Enable=true
  86.         FixTime=[
  87.             "12:00"
  88.         ]
  89.         Hover="&e↓点击打开↓"
  90.         Interval=60
  91.         Join=true
  92.         ModeCode=interval
  93.         Setting {
  94.             Boss {
  95.                 持续时间=10
  96.                 颜色=PURPLE
  97.             }
  98.             Title {
  99.                 持续时间=2
  100.                 淡入时间=1
  101.                 淡出时间=1
  102.             }
  103.         }
  104.         Url=None
  105.     }
  106.     "NO.5" {
  107.         Cmd=None
  108.         Content="&f[&b萌主公告&f]&AAT功能:输入&N&b@[玩家]&A,就可以在服务器里AT玩家啦~"
  109.         DelayOnStart=320
  110.         Display=normal
  111.         Enable=true
  112.         FixTime=[
  113.             "12:00"
  114.         ]
  115.         Hover=""
  116.         Interval=60
  117.         Join=false
  118.         ModeCode=interval
  119.         Setting {
  120.             Boss {
  121.                 持续时间=10
  122.                 颜色=PURPLE
  123.             }
  124.             Title {
  125.                 持续时间=2
  126.                 淡入时间=1
  127.                 淡出时间=1
  128.             }
  129.         }
  130.         Url=None
  131.     }
  132.     "NO.6" {
  133.         Cmd=None
  134.         Content="&f[&b萌主公告&f]&a进服务器发现mod物品变为&n&5紫色方块&a请&n重新进入服务器"
  135.         DelayOnStart=400
  136.         Display=normal
  137.         Enable=true
  138.         FixTime=[
  139.             "12:00"
  140.         ]
  141.         Hover="这个问题是暂时无法解决,但不影响游戏体验,还请谅解"
  142.         Interval=60
  143.         Join=false
  144.         ModeCode=interval
  145.         Setting {
  146.             Boss {
  147.                 持续时间=10
  148.                 颜色=PURPLE
  149.             }
  150.             Title {
  151.                 持续时间=2
  152.                 淡入时间=1
  153.                 淡出时间=1
  154.             }
  155.         }
  156.         Url=None
  157.     }
  158. }
复制代码

dogeggson
公告内容有办法换行吗?

Eric12324
dogeggson 发表于 2020-4-27 22:28
公告内容有办法换行吗?

不能,不过理论上你可以这样,两条公告,相同间隔时间,然后一条的启动延迟比另一条长零点几秒,这样他会稳定的出现在另一条的后面,等同于换行效果

爱笑的节操
非常不错的插件,支持支持

dogeggson
Eric12324 发表于 2020-4-27 22:34
不能,不过理论上你可以这样,两条公告,相同间隔时间,然后一条的启动延迟比另一条长零点几秒,这样他会 ...

请问启动延迟在哪设置?

七宫安澄
看起来不错,感谢,加油

Eric12324
dogeggson 发表于 2020-4-28 03:54
请问启动延迟在哪设置?

在配置文件里,如果你用的是最新的版本的话,会有一个DelayOnStart,这个参数指这条公告在服务器完成启动后等待多少秒开始执行循环,只有间隔模式才有效,固定时间点模式无效,这个参数只能直接通过配置文件改

676065874
插件不错,支持

233的石头
希望能加一个轮播模式,写了好几条公告过一会就唰一下全都出来了

Eric12324
233的石头 发表于 2020-7-6 17:34
希望能加一个轮播模式,写了好几条公告过一会就唰一下全都出来了

给公告设置不同的间隔时间,并且不要互成倍数,比如300,600这种
或者在配置文件中设置delayOnstart参数

233的石头
Eric12324 发表于 2020-7-7 11:22
给公告设置不同的间隔时间,并且不要互成倍数,比如300,600这种
或者在配置文件中设置delayOnstart参数 ...

啊这个之前想到过,但这样的话会造成有的频繁有的偶尔才能出现的情况

Eric12324
233的石头 发表于 2020-7-7 16:18
啊这个之前想到过,但这样的话会造成有的频繁有的偶尔才能出现的情况

那就设置delayOnStart, 可以让相同间隔时间的公告不叠在一起,相同间隔时间的公告有不同的delayOnStart秒数就不会叠在一起。这个参数的意义是:对应的公告在服务器启动完成后等待多少秒再开始循环公告

し不懂丶装懂つ
mcbbs有你更精彩

xiongjilei
1.12.2 cat端无法使用

Eric12324
xiongjilei 发表于 2021-4-22 16:21
1.12.2 cat端无法使用

Sponge端用的

一苏解说
6666666666666666666666666

你恁碟
很好的插件

247124714399q
这插件也太好用了吧!谢谢分享啊!

第一页 上一页 下一页 最后一页